要把Vue学得更好,关键在于1、掌握基础知识,2、积极实践,3、深入理解原理,4、参与社区交流。首先,确保你对Vue的基础知识有扎实的掌握,包括Vue的基本概念、指令、组件、生命周期等。其次,通过实际项目和练习来巩固你的知识。第三,深入了解Vue的设计原理和源码,这将帮助你在遇到复杂问题时能够更加游刃有余。最后,积极参与社区交流,分享经验并从他人那里学习。以下是详细的解释和步骤。
一、掌握基础知识
-
学习基础概念:
- Vue实例:了解Vue实例的创建和基本用法。
- 模板语法:掌握插值、指令(如v-bind、v-model等)。
- 计算属性与侦听器:理解如何使用computed和watch。
- 组件基础:学习如何创建和使用组件。
-
文档阅读:
- 官方文档是最好的学习资源,详细阅读并理解每个章节内容。
- 通过文档中的示例代码进行实践,加深理解。
-
基础项目练习:
- 从简单的项目开始,如Todo List、计数器等,逐步提高难度。
二、积极实践
-
实际项目:
- 参与实际项目开发,将理论知识应用到实践中。
- 尝试使用Vue构建一个完整的应用,如博客系统、电商平台等。
-
开源项目参与:
- 找到一些开源的Vue项目,阅读源码并尝试贡献代码。
- 在GitHub上搜索Vue相关的开源项目,参与issue讨论和提交PR。
-
练习平台:
- 使用在线练习平台(如CodePen、JSFiddle)进行小项目的快速开发和测试。
三、深入理解原理
-
Vue的设计原理:
- 学习Vue的响应式原理,了解数据绑定和虚拟DOM的工作机制。
- 深入理解Vue的生命周期钩子,掌握各个阶段的用途。
-
源码分析:
- 阅读Vue的源码,了解其内部实现。
- 通过源码分析,理解Vue的设计思想和实现细节。
-
高级特性:
- 学习Vue的高级特性,如Vue Router、Vuex等。
- 理解这些工具的工作原理和使用场景。
四、参与社区交流
-
在线社区:
- 加入Vue相关的在线社区,如论坛、微信群、Slack等。
- 在社区中提问和回答问题,分享你的学习经验。
-
技术博客:
- 阅读和撰写技术博客,记录学习过程中的心得体会。
- 通过撰写博客,整理和巩固自己的知识。
-
技术会议和讲座:
- 参加Vue相关的技术会议、讲座和工作坊。
- 与其他开发者交流,了解最新的技术动态和最佳实践。
总结与建议
通过掌握基础知识、积极实践、深入理解原理和参与社区交流,你可以全面提升对Vue的掌握和应用能力。建议你制定详细的学习计划,逐步推进每个阶段的学习目标。同时,多参与实践项目和社区活动,不断积累经验和提升技能。这样不仅能让你更好地掌握Vue,还能在实际工作中得心应手。
相关问答FAQs:
Q: 为什么学习Vue对于前端开发者来说很重要?
A: 学习Vue对于前端开发者来说非常重要,原因如下:
- Vue是一种现代的JavaScript框架,它能够帮助开发者构建交互式的用户界面。在Web应用程序的开发过程中,用户界面是至关重要的,因为它直接与用户进行交互。Vue提供了一种简洁、直观的方式来处理用户界面的构建,使得开发者能够更加高效地创建出吸引人的应用程序。
- Vue具有良好的可扩展性。它采用了组件化的开发模式,使得开发者能够将应用程序拆分成多个独立的组件,每个组件都有自己的状态和行为。这种组件化的开发模式使得应用程序更加易于维护和扩展,开发者能够更加灵活地重用和组合组件,提高开发效率。
- Vue具有丰富的生态系统。Vue拥有大量的社区插件和工具,能够满足不同开发需求。开发者可以根据自己的项目需求选择合适的插件和工具,从而提高开发效率和项目质量。
- Vue具有很好的文档和教程资源。官方文档详尽地介绍了Vue的各个方面,包括核心概念、API文档和示例代码等。此外,还有许多社区和个人创作的教程和博客文章,提供了丰富的学习资源,帮助开发者更好地理解和应用Vue。
Q: 如何开始学习Vue?
A: 开始学习Vue的步骤如下:
- 学习基本的HTML、CSS和JavaScript知识。Vue是基于JavaScript的框架,因此在学习Vue之前,你需要对HTML、CSS和JavaScript有一定的了解。
- 了解Vue的核心概念。Vue的核心概念包括:组件、响应式数据、指令和生命周期钩子等。你可以通过阅读官方文档来了解这些概念,并通过实践来加深理解。
- 安装和配置Vue开发环境。你可以通过npm或者yarn来安装Vue,并且可以使用Vue CLI来快速搭建一个基于Vue的开发环境。
- 实践编写Vue应用程序。通过编写小型的Vue应用程序,你可以加深对Vue的理解,并且熟悉Vue的API和常用的开发模式。
- 参与开源项目或者实际项目。在实际的项目中应用Vue,可以帮助你更好地掌握Vue的使用技巧和最佳实践。
Q: 如何提高Vue的学习效果?
A: 提高Vue的学习效果的方法如下:
- 阅读官方文档。Vue的官方文档是学习Vue最重要的资源之一,它详细地介绍了Vue的各个方面。你可以通过阅读官方文档来了解Vue的核心概念、API和最佳实践。
- 参与社区讨论。Vue拥有庞大的社区,你可以在社区中提问、分享和讨论Vue相关的问题和经验。通过与其他开发者的交流,你可以学习到更多的Vue技巧和实践经验。
- 实践编写Vue应用程序。通过编写实际的Vue应用程序,你可以将理论知识转化为实践经验。在实际的项目中,你会遇到各种各样的问题和挑战,通过解决这些问题,你可以提高对Vue的理解和应用能力。
- 阅读源码。Vue的源码是开放的,你可以阅读Vue的源码来深入理解Vue的实现原理和设计思想。通过阅读源码,你可以学习到更多的高级技巧和最佳实践。
- 参加培训课程或线上教育平台。如果你想系统地学习Vue,可以参加一些专门的培训课程或者在线教育平台。这些课程和平台通常会提供更加系统和结构化的学习材料,帮助你快速入门和提高。
通过以上的方法,你可以更好地学习和掌握Vue,提高自己的前端开发能力。
文章标题:如何把vue学的更好,发布者:worktile,转载请注明出处:https://worktile.com/kb/p/3604054